Automobile Museum of Provence (Musee Automobile de Provence) is located near Nîmes. Nîmes is a commune in the south of France, prefecture of the Gard department in the Occitania region (at the foothills of the Massif Central).

! As of 2024 the museum is permanently closed! all-andorra.com

Its collection is a summary of a century of automotive history through different periods.

Sports and popular cars, motorcycles, and bicycles of all ages are available.

The entrance is free.
